Sony Updates PS3 In Preparation For Vita Release

Console to be used alongside new handheld...

Wednesday 30th November 2011 by Alex Winehouse

Sony have announced that an impeding firmware update will add Vita functionality to the PlayStation 3.

The update, v4.00, enables PS3 owners to use the console as a content hub for the handheld, the PlayStation blog reports.

This will allow them to share games, photos and other content betweent the PS3 and Vita, as well as backing up the Vita's save data onto the console's hard drive.

In addition, users will be able to update the Vita's firmware via the PS3.

PlayStation Vita launches in Japan on December 17, coming to North America and Europe on February 22, 2012.
